NEW YORK CITY — Meridian Investment Sales has arranged the sale of a newly renovated commercial building at 2857 West 8th St. in Brooklyn for $23 million. David Schechtman and Rich Velotta of Meridian represented the undisclosed seller and procured the unidentified buyer in the transaction. Located in the West Brighton neighborhood of Brooklyn, the 52,302-square-foot office building is fully leased. The tenant roster includes New York City Human Resources Administration, Blink Fitness and Dollar Tree. The two-story building also has a Verizon cell and GPS tower on the roof. The property was recently renovated to include a new façade, an updated plumbing system and electrical upgrades.

PLYMOUTH, MASS. — Fantini & Gorga has arranged $3.5 million in land development financing for a 40-acre parcel in Plymouth. The lender was a major Massachusetts-based banking institution. Harald LLC, the borrower, plans to add roads and utilities, and then subdivide the commercially zoned land into five or six parcels, to be sold for additional development.The site, about 40 miles south of Boston, is located near the Grove at Plymouth shopping center. Tenants at the retail center include a 130,000-square foot Home Depot store, West Marine, Ethan Allen Furniture and Mattress Firm.

COSTA MESA, CALIF. — SRS Real Estate Partners has arranged the $2.4 million sale of a ground lease in the Orange County community of Costa Mesa. The 0.8-acre parcel of land currently houses a 13,200-square-foot property. The asset is triple-net leased to a Los Angeles-based entity that subleases the property to multiple tenants. Michael Walseth of SRS represented the undisclosed, Orange County-based seller in the transaction. The buyer, also based in Orange County, represented itself. The ground lease had approximately 14 years remaining.

DUBUQUE, IOWA — The DESCO Group has purchased Warren Plaza in Dubuque for an undisclosed price. A Hy-Vee grocery store anchors the 96,310-square-foot shopping center, which is 90 percent leased to additional tenants such as Super Cuts, Video Games Etc!, Miracle Ear and Great Dragon. The property is situated on 13 acres at 3500 Dodge St. Amy Sands, Clinton Mitchell and Jules Sherwood of HFF marketed the property on behalf of the seller, Brixmor Property Group. Christopher Knight of HFF arranged a fixed-rate loan on behalf of DESCO for the acquisition.

JACKSONVILLE, FLA. — Colliers International has arranged the $12.7 million sale of San Jose Plaza, a 95,433-square-foot shopping center in Jacksonville. Scott Rogers of Colliers arranged the transaction on behalf of the buyer, SJP Jax LLC, which acquired the asset from Shanri Holdings Corp. Bonefish Grill anchors the center, which was 75 percent leased at the time of sale to 30 tenants. A second anchor tenant, Aldi, will open this summer.

LA VERNE, CALIF. — Hanley Investment Group Real Estate Advisors has arranged the sale of La Verne Courtyard, an 84,368-square-foot shopping center in La Verne, located 30 miles east of Los Angeles. The sales price was not disclosed, but The Real Deal reports Evan & MC LLC acquired the asset from Charles Co. for $20.7 million. Ed Hanley, Bill Asher and Kevin Fryman of Hanley arranged the transaction on behalf of the seller, while Wendy Wong and Katherine Quach of Treelane Realty Group represented the buyer. La Verne Courtyard was 97 percent leased at the time of sale to tenants such as Aldi, Orchard Supply Hardware, Jersey Mike’s Subs, Pacific Dental, OneMain Financial, Pizza Hut and Rubio’s.

PHILADELPHIA — Kimco Realty’s Lincoln Square mixed-use project currently under development will be the site of Philadelphia’s first Sprouts Farmers Market. The 32,000-square-foot store is part of the adaptive reuse of Lincoln Square’s historic train station and will incorporate the Gothic Revival elements of the property. Work on the redevelopment project at the corner of South Broad Street and Washington Avenue, began in late 2016. Sprouts is one of the fastest growing grocers in the United States and has opened 30 stores in 2018. Other retail tenants that have signed on to the development include Target, PetSmart, Starbucks and Sprint. The project will also include 322 residential units. Residential move-ins are planned to begin this summer, with Sprouts set to open in the third quarter of 2018.

FARMINGTON, CONN. — New England Retail Properties has brokered the sale of the Tractor Supply store located at 361 Scott Swamp Road in Farmington for $3.6 million. New England Retail Properties arranged the transaction between the seller, AEI Property Corp., and the buyer, 361 Scott Swamp Road LLC. The property, a former Frank’s Nursery & Crafts, was acquired in 2010 and opened in 2011 as a Tractor Supply store after a retrofit of the building and grounds. The property, which is nine miles west of Hartford, serves the Farmington, Burlington, Plainville and surrounding markets. Founded in 1939, Tractor Supply has more than 1,700 stores in 49 states.

IRVING, TEXAS — HFF has negotiated the sale of Shops at MacArthur Hills, a 75,387-square-foot retail center located within the 12,000-acre Las Colinas district in Irving. Anchored by Whole Foods Market, the property was fully leased at the time of sale to tenants such as Zoës Kitchen, Fidelity Investments, Pure Barre and Sprint. Ryan Shore, Barry Brown, Jim Batjer and Aaron Johnson of HFF represented the seller, Dallas-based investment Leon Capital Group, in the transaction. New York-based Clarion Partners LLC purchased the asset free and clear of existing debt. The sales price was not disclosed.
